Title: The Innovative Mind of Geoffrey Russell Atkinson
Introduction
Geoffrey Russell Atkinson, an accomplished inventor based in Salt Lake City, UT, has made significant contributions to the fields of e-commerce and electronic communication. With two patents to his name, Atkinson's work focuses on enhancing the user experience and providing sellers with valuable market insights.
Latest Patents
Atkinson's latest inventions include the "Positioning E-commerce Product Related to Graphical Imputed Consumer Demand." This patent outlines a system that allows sellers to visualize consumer demand for potential product listings through graphical representations. By aggregating product preference criteria from multiple consumers, the system provides sellers insight into market trends, enabling them to price and position their products intelligently. His second patent, "System, Program Product, and Method of Electronic Communication Network Guided Navigation," offers users a more efficient way to filter product search results. By guiding users through their search intentions, the system ensures quick and relevant information retrieval.
